A leading recruitment agency in Newcastle is seeking a Maths Graduate Teaching Assistant for a specialist SEMH school. The role involves supporting pupils with their Maths learning, managing behaviour, and assisting teachers with engaging activities.
Ideal candidates will hold a degree in Maths and possess strong communication skills. This full-time position offers a salary between £85 and £110 per day, and candidates must have an enhanced DBS check or be willing to get one.

How to prepare for a job interview at GSL Education - Newcastle
✨Know Your Maths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on your Maths knowledge before the interview. Be prepared to discuss key concepts and how you would explain them to students with varying abilities. This will show your passion for the subject and your ability to communicate effectively.
✨Understand SEMH Needs
Familiarise yourself with Social, Emotional, and Mental Health (SEMH) needs. Research strategies for managing behaviour and supporting students who may struggle emotionally. This understanding will demonstrate your commitment to creating a positive learning environment.
✨Engage with Practical Examples
Think of engaging activities or teaching methods you could use in the classroom. Be ready to share specific examples during the interview that highlight your creativity and ability to connect with students. This will help you stand out as a candidate who can make learning fun.
✨Prepare Questions for Them
Have a few thoughtful questions ready to ask the interviewers about the school and its approach to teaching Maths.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if the school is the right fit for you.
